DCs asked to reallocate unused BSCIC lands to new entrepreneurs

UNB, Dhaka :
Industries Minister Amir Hossain Amu on Wednesday said the Deputy Commissioners (DCs) have been asked to reallocate the unused lands of Bangladesh Small & Cottage Industries Corporation (BSCIC) to new entrepreneurs.
“There’re some plots in different BSCIC areas in different districts which had been allotted earlier but still remain unused. The DCs have been asked to cancel the allotments and reallocate the plots to new entrepreneurs,” he said.
Amu was briefing reporters after attending a joint session of Commerce and Industries Ministries with the DCs on the second day of their three-day conference in the city.
The Industries Minister said his ministry will provide all kinds of assistance, including industrial plots and bank loan, if anyone wants to set up new industries in the country.
He also said the DCs have been asked to work sincerely to build planned industrial zones in their respective areas using industrial potentials.
